Palmdale Climate

Palmdale has an average annual temperature of 15.9°C (61°F) and receives about 284 mm of precipitation per year. The warmest month is July and the coldest is January. Figures are 1970–2000 climate normals.

Palmdale — monthly temperature & precipitation (1970–2000 normals) · Source: WorldClim 2.1
MonthAvg (°C/°F)Precip
January7° / 45°54 mm
February9° / 48°56 mm
March11° / 51°46 mm
April14° / 56°17 mm
May18° / 64°6 mm
June23° / 73°2 mm
July26° / 79°2 mm
August26° / 79°4 mm
September23° / 73°8 mm
October17° / 63°8 mm
November11° / 52°38 mm
December7° / 45°43 mm

1970–2000 normals from WorldClim 2.1 (~9 km grid). Precipitation can be less precise near mountains or coastlines, where rainfall varies sharply over short distances.

Best time to visit Palmdale

The most comfortable months to visit Palmdale are typically June, September and May, when temperatures are mildest and rainfall is relatively low. The hottest month is July (around 35°C high). The coldest is January (near 1°C low). February is usually the wettest month.
